Exechesops is a genus of beetles belonging to the family Anthribidae.[1] Males of some species such as E. leucopis have a tubular eye projection, and the eye span determines outcomes of male-male combat.[2]

The species of this genus are found in Eastern Europe, Southern Africa, Southeastern Asia.[1]
